Default Help!! anybody here can help me out?

well, my windows doesnt have a system sound, while there are sounds when i play music or movies...what should i do??

i can't even hear the sound of msn messenger...and i have tried every setup to set the sound, but it didnt work anyhow...

i dont wanna reinstall my computer again---i know it will work if i install my system again...but i got so many import things on my computer and i dont have too much time to install it....


what do i do now?

Click START, CONTROL PANEL, SOUNDS AND AUDIO DEVICES then click the tab that says "SOUNDS". When your there, click on the drop down box and select "windows default" as your sound scheme. That should fix it. Post back if you need anything else.

Right click on MY Computer then properties then go to the hardware tap then click on device manager. In the device look for sound, video and game controllers pull down menu (if there is one if there is one) also look for any ? and red X's in this menu. If there is no sound, video and game controllers pull down menu then you are going to need to reinstall the device drivers for the sound card.

Reinstall your sound drivers. If you dont know what drivers are then tell us what sound card you have and we should be able to find the correct drivers for you. If you dont know what sound card then go start, run, type in dxdiag. then go to sound tab and tell what sound card you have.
